Inserted in the triangular space, the artist performs within it, taking ownership of this unusual area, creating relationships between its limits and her movements. We do not know for sure whether she wants to break away from the triangle, to free herself, or whether she is supporting herself on the edges of the acute angle.

Celina Portella

b. 1977, Rio de Janeiro (RJ), Brazil | Lives and works in Rio de Janeiro (RJ), Brazil.

Celina Portella investigates issues related to the representation of the body through video and photography. She was awarded the 1st Program for the Promotion of Rio de Janeiro Culture in Visual Arts, the Support Grant for Creation from the State Secretariat of Culture, and the grant from the Art and Technology Center of EAV Parque Lage in Rio de Janeiro. She won an award at the 2nd Fundaj Video Art Competition in Recife and participated in a residency at the Centre international d'accueil et d'échanges des Récollets in Paris and the LABMIS residency at the Museum of Image and Sound in São Paulo, among others. Among her participations in group exhibitions, the highlights are "Nova Arte Nova" at the Banco do Brasil Cultural Center (Rio de Janeiro and São Paulo); "III Mostra do Programa de Exposições do Centro Cultural São Paulo"; "Mostra SESC de Artes" (São Paulo); "60o Salão de Abril" (Fortaleza); and the "15o Salão da Bahia". As a dancer and co-creator, she worked with choreographers Lia Rodrigues and João Saldanha.
